These three poly unsaturated fatty acids are essential for maintaining proper functioning of the body. Out of these three omega fatty acids, omega 3 and 6 are essential fatty acids or EFA's. We have to include omega 3 and 6 fatty acids in our diet, since our body cannot manufacture it. Where as, omega 9 is not an essential and it can be easily manufactured by our body form other sources.

Omega 3 is a major component promoting in maintaining a balanced level of triglyceride and cholesterol. EPA and DHA are examples of two main fatty acids included in omega 3 family. Anti- inflammatory and anti-coagulation property of omega 3 prevents the risk of arthritis and cardiovascular diseases. Normalizing lipid levels, reducing the blood pressure level and enhancing the rate of glucose metabolism are other benefits of taking omega 3 supplements.
